iOSエンジニア in ハードウェア・プロジェクト
本日開催された「yidev 恵比寿勉強会」にて、 ハードまわり(メカや電子回路)の知識やスキルを持たない iOS エンジニアが、ハードウェア関連プロジェクトにどのような立ち位置で関わるのか、という内容の発表をしました。
一般論ではなく、あくまで僕が入ったプロジェクトはこうでした、という個人的経験談でしかないのですが、ガジェット開発に興味はあるけど電子回路とかわからない、という僕と同じような方々の参考になれば幸いです。
・・・というテーマのつもりだったのですが二日酔いの状態で資料をつくり、発表したので、何が言いたいのかよくわからない散漫な感じになってしまいました。。
結論としては、最後の「まとめ」スライド *1 に書いたように、
ハードの知識がない iOS エンジニアでも、ハード関連プロジェクトに楽しく関われます!
- Core Bluetooth / BLE まわりの知識は大事
- BLEモジュールのファームまわりもできると捗る
という感じです。
以下に参考記事/関連記事をズラズラと載せておきます。
iBeacon 関連記事
- http://d.hatena.ne.jp/shu223/20140326/1395835542
- http://d.hatena.ne.jp/shu223/20140406/1396754855
- http://d.hatena.ne.jp/shu223/20140304/1393908483
- http://d.hatena.ne.jp/shu223/20140304/1393887807
- http://d.hatena.ne.jp/shu223/20140131/1391155397
- http://d.hatena.ne.jp/shu223/20131223/1387872540
- http://d.hatena.ne.jp/shu223/20131219/1387448941
BLE, CoreBluetooth 関連記事
konashi 関連記事
- 第1回 「konashi」とiOSアプリを連携させる:iOSアプリと連携させて使えるデバイスたち|gihyo.jp … 技術評論社
- http://d.hatena.ne.jp/shu223/20140127/1391073429
*1:発表時にはこれがなく、アップする際に追加しました